Vanessa's character in Five Nights at Freddy's 2 adds an exciting twist to the original villain storyline. In the first film, she starts off as a police officer but ends up playing a supporting role to Mike, the main character. Together, they work to uncover the mysteries surrounding the abandoned pizza parlor and Mike's strange dreams about his brother being kidnapped. Their growing friendship sets the stage for a shocking plot twist.

As the story unfolds, it is revealed that Vanessa is actually the daughter of William Afton, the notorious serial killer responsible for the haunted animatronics at Freddy Fazbear's Pizza. In the climactic final showdown, Vanessa confronts her father, who discloses his sinister plan for her to eliminate Mike and his sister Abby. Following their intense confrontation, Vanessa is left in a coma after sustaining injuries from Afton. The film concludes with Mike and Abby visiting her in the hospital, leaving viewers on edge for what comes next.

How Vanessa Being A Killer Would Help Make William Afton's FNAF Villain Twist Better

Vanessa's portrayal as a villain in the movie not only stays true to her video game character but also seamlessly paves the way for the main antagonist. In the game, Vanessa is depicted as a ruthless serial killer who has taken the lives of nine children. This merciless nature carries over to her character in Five Nights at Freddy's: Security Breach. Bringing these elements from the game to the big screen in Five Nights at Freddy's 2 aligns Vanessa perfectly as the antagonist of the film. Moreover, her presence from the first movie sets the stage for the sequel without wasting any time.

In Five Nights at Freddy's 2, Vanessa being portrayed as the villain adds an interesting twist to the story. It deepens the character of Afton by showcasing the impact of his actions on his family. Vanessa's involvement in her father's dark deeds, such as allowing him to harm children, reveals her questionable morals. Her desire for revenge on Mike after assisting him further emphasizes the psychological wounds inflicted by Afton.

It would add another layer to the film if Mike had to face off with someone he thought he could trust, making their confrontation even more exciting. Vanessa's villain arc in Five Nights at Freddy's 2 would show how Afton's evil persists despite his defeat. The hints of her potential villain arc were already present in the first movie, despite her resistance and fear of Afton. Bringing those hints to fruition in the next film would create a more engaging and compelling story for viewers.
